"For more than 5 years, after reading academic papers every morning, thru hurricane, divorce, financial collapse, pandemic, and practically every obstacle a human being could endure, it was not easy staying on track, executing each painting, gathering amazing folk to model in period clothing for photoshoots for each theme, and just flatout trusting in myself and my work, to bring new light to the world about one of the most misunderstood and misrepresented cultures on the planet, my ancestors, The Norse.
This are gallery book showcases not the dark stories of the "Vikings" that were written about them centuries later after the Viking Age. This story I have chosen to bring is a day in the life story of folk who were originally farmers, hunters, fishermen, and skilled craftspeople who ultimately became merchants, that traveled much of the know world, eventually colonizing an area encompassing parts of North America, Iceland, Greenland, modern Scandinavia today, and much of central Europe all the way to Siberia, with colonies having been in Spain and north Africa as well.
